在繁华的济宁,公共交通作为市民出行的重要方式,已经成为大家日常生活中不可或缺的一部分。为了让大家出行更加便捷,现在就让我来为大家详细介绍济宁公交出行必备的APP,如何轻松查询路线、实时到站,让你告别等车烦恼。
1. 简单易用的界面设计
济宁公交出行APP拥有简洁明了的界面设计,用户只需轻轻一点,即可进入查询界面。整个APP分为首页、路线查询、站点查询、实时到站、出行建议等几个模块,每个模块的功能都一目了然,非常适合不同年龄段的用户使用。
2. 精准的路线查询
在路线查询模块,用户可以轻松查找济宁市区内所有公交线路,包括常规线路、夜班车、旅游专线等。同时,APP支持跨线路换乘,只需输入起点和终点,即可智能推荐多条出行方案。
示例代码(Python):
def query_bus_routes(start, end):
# 模拟查询路线的函数
routes = [
{'start': '市府广场', 'end': '火车站', 'via': '1路、2路、3路'},
{'start': '火车站', 'end': '汽车北站', 'via': '4路、5路、6路'},
{'start': '汽车北站', 'end': '市府广场', 'via': '7路、8路、9路'}
]
for route in routes:
if route['start'] == start and route['end'] == end:
return route['via']
return "暂无直达路线"
# 查询从市府广场到火车站的路线
start = '市府广场'
end = '火车站'
result = query_bus_routes(start, end)
print(f"从{start}到{end}的路线:{result}")
3. 实时到站查询
在实时到站模块,用户可以查看任意一条线路在各个站点的实时到站信息,包括距离当前站点的距离和预计到站时间。这样,用户可以提前做好下车准备,避免错过公交车。
示例代码(Python):
def query_bus_arrival(time):
# 模拟查询到站时间的函数
arrivals = {
'1路': {'next_stop': '市府广场', 'time': '10:30'},
'2路': {'next_stop': '火车站', 'time': '10:35'},
'3路': {'next_stop': '汽车北站', 'time': '10:40'}
}
return arrivals[time]
# 查询1路车在市府广场的到站时间
time = '1路'
result = query_bus_arrival(time)
print(f"{time}在市府广场的到站时间为:{result['time']}")
4. 出行建议
出行建议模块会根据用户的当前位置、目的地和天气状况,为用户推荐最佳出行路线和时间。同时,APP还会提供周边公交站点、公交服务热线等信息,为用户解决出行中的各种问题。
总结
济宁公交出行APP以其简洁易用的界面、精准的路线查询、实时到站查询等功能,为市民提供了便捷的出行体验。通过使用这个APP,相信大家都能轻松应对等车烦恼,愉快地享受公交出行带来的便利。